  • Hi!! We live in Chaska and are first time parents. We had the same situation where none of our friends have children yet, so I had no reccomendations. I called childcare resource and referral for Carver county. They then gave me a long list of providers. I looked FOREVER for in home daycares, and did 12 interviews! We settled on a lady in Chanhassen who is close to my work. Our daughter starts there the beg. of December. If you would like her phone number send me a PM. AND GOOD LUCK searching for child care can be frustrating..just be picky!!!

  • Most lics providers can only have one infant under 12 months at a time that is why it is hard to find infant spots. If you don't need a spot until August then you have lots of time to call around.
